When I capture video I suffer a very slight sync problem. I get around this by setting the audio stream as master and I end up with a file at 24.996fps and audio at48000. I use CCE to encode, which will happily accept video frame rates between 24.991 and 25.009 without complaining, but this obviously leads to the audio then being out of sync again. I usually stretch the audio to match using wavelab. I'm just curious to know if I would get a better quality result by keeping to 25fps (video master or via avisynth script - assume fps...) and then resampling the audio rather than stretching it?

it depends, most strecthing algorythms are not that good, but in your case it is such a small amount that most programs would still do a good job i think.
on the other end, if you resample the change in pitch would be so low that that wouldnt be noticable either.

just a matter of taste i guess :)
